NeuroRestorative of Elk Grove is a medical clinic in Elk Grove, CA, providing rehabilitation services for people of all ages with brain and spinal cord injuries, complex illnesses, and behavioral health challenges. The facility serves both adults and children, offering support through residential rehabilitation, outpatient programs, day programs, and behavioral health services. Since 1977, the organization has operated as a provider of therapeutic and rehabilitation care, helping individuals build the skills needed to return to their daily lives. The clinic holds a rating of 3.90 based on 10 reviews.
The clinic offers a range of care settings, including inpatient medically complex care, skilled nursing programs, transitional services, in-home supports, and vocational programs. Services are tailored to individual needs, whether the goal is learning to walk again, returning to work or school, or living independently. The team includes medical directors, nurses, therapists, counselors, and support staff who work with patients to understand their specific goals. NeuroRestorative works with insurance companies and public funding sources to help individuals access the rehabilitation services they require. The admissions process involves gathering information, scheduling clinical screenings, and arranging family tours to ensure a smooth start for new patients.
